I like what the Tennessee Titans did last April
I really like what the Titans did last April. The Titans took QB Jake Locker in the first round (#8 overall) to be the QB of the future. Locker would have likely been the #1 overall pick if he came out after his junior season in 2010, so the Titans are getting value here. He is a swashbuckling type QB as he uses his strong arm to try to fit the ball into tight windows. He also is a good runner. RB Jamie Harper was a very solid pick for the Titans in the 4th round. He’s a power runner and he will give the Titans’ offense a different look when he gives Chris Johnson a break. OLB Akeem Ayers, DT Jurrell Casey, LB Colin McCarthy and DE Karl Klug give the Titans a nice group of defensive players to help out.
PROJECTED GRADE: B
